鼠標懸停的css動畫是一種可以通過css代碼實現的交互效果。當用戶將鼠標移到指定元素上時,相應的動畫效果就會觸發。這種動畫效果可以用來增強用戶體驗,提高頁面互動性。
使用css代碼實現鼠標懸停的動畫效果,需要將要觸發動畫效果的元素用:hover偽類選擇器來定位。然后,通過設置CSS屬性的變化,來觸發相應的動畫效果。
下面是一個將鼠標懸停時改變字體大小的動畫樣例,代碼如下:
請將鼠標移動到下面的文本上觀察效果:
.hover-effect { font-size: 16px; transition: font-size 0.5s ease-out; } .hover-effect:hover { font-size: 20px; }通過上面的代碼,我們可以看到,當鼠標移到包含類名為.hover-effect的元素上時,文本的字體大小會由16px變為20px。這個動畫效果的變化時間為0.5秒(通過transition屬性設置),效果呈“ease-out”緩和的變化。 除了改變字體大小,我們還可以通過設置其他屬性,例如顏色、背景圖案等來實現更復雜的鼠標懸停動畫效果。需要注意的是,動畫效果的變化時間、緩和設置等屬性,需要適當調整,以達到更好的用戶體驗效果。 以上是一個簡單的鼠標懸停動畫的實現例子。通過學習這些基礎的css動畫效果,你可以自己嘗試設計更多有趣的鼠標懸停動畫效果,來增強頁面的交互性,提高用戶體驗。